What affects the price

When you look at dental bills, the final amount depends on several variables. The biggest factors are the complexity of the procedure and the materials used, such as whether a crown is porcelain or gold. If you have insurance, that impacts your out-of-pocket share, while those paying cash might see different rates based on the office's overhead. What exactly is a dentist?

A dentist is a healthcare professional who diagnoses, treats, and prevents diseases of the oral cavity. This includes your teeth, gums, tongue, and mouth. What tooth is hardest to remove?

Wisdom teeth are generally the most difficult to extract because they are often impacted or located in a hard-to-reach area. Their roots can also be complex.
